Arkansas Territory General Assembly records, 1819-1820; 1835

 

Arkansas Territory was established on March 2, 1819, following Missouri’s petition for statehood. The territory existed until it became a state on June 15, 1836. The territorial capital was established at Arkansas Post, but moved to Little Rock in 1821. James Miller served as the first governor and Robert Crittenden as the first secretary of the territory. On November 20, 1819, Crittenden held elections to create a general assembly, which first convened in February 1820.

This collection contains bound volumes of enrolled bills and acts from Arkansas Territory.
